By what process are gases exchanged between the blood and the lungs
DiKsa [7]
Diffusion is the spontaneous movement of gases, without the use of any energy or effort by the body, between the gas in the alveoli and the blood in the capillaries in the lungs. Perfusion is the process by which the cardiovascular system pumps blood throughout the lungs.

11)El ciclo del agua, conocido científicamente como ciclo hidrológico, se refiere al intercambio continuo de agua en la hidrosfera, entre la atmósfera, el agua del suelo, la superficie, el agua subterránea y las plantas. La ciencia que estudia el ciclo hidrológico es la hidrología.

12)Sabems que las etapas del ciclo hidrológico  son las siguientes:

Evaporación

Condensación

Precipitación.

Las implicaciones que tienen para la vida cada una de las etapas son:

Evaporación, se reduce el nivel de los ríos, los lagos pequeños se seca, y se eleva la temperatura del ambiente.

Condensación, Es el proceso en el cual se forman las nubes, por lo que la luz solar disminuye.

Precipitación, produce nuevamente el aumento de los niveles de rios y lagos, y la disminución de la temperatura.
